Nancy Toppan Little papers
Scope and Contents
The Nancy Toppan Little Papers contain correspondence to her family from her enrollment at Smith College in 1914 until her graduation in 1918. The papers also contain materials relating to her college career, including a memorabilia book, class songs, programs from Smith theatrical events, and memoirs of her 45th and 60th college reunions.

Biographical / Historical
Nancy Toppan Little, class of 1918, lived her entire life in Newburyport, Massachusetts. During her four years at Smith she studied Math, English, German, History, Latin, Biblical Literature, Geology, Philosophy, Physics, Economics and Physical Education and was a member of the Math Club. She also taught classes in Arithmetic and Geography at the People's Institute of Northampton. Between her graduation and her marriage on June 16, 1920 to Herbert Greenleaf Noyes, also of Newburyport, she worked briefly as a bank clerk. Her sixty-one-year marriage produced three sons, nine grandchildren and many great-grandchildren. Until her death in 1995, Little delighted in outdoor walks and visits from her large family.
